Output d7820eea6a8fa58034664f35f5dcd86b6a779c7a003a3577e26e8fbb685559cb:76

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d93acfd72c4d983a3d4f72c2787a44e419b8fda2a4d5538071a9e8c8abbabca
address
bc1p3kf6eltjcnvc8g757ukz0payfeqehr769fx42wq8r20gez4m409qyk0k3q
transaction
d7820eea6a8fa58034664f35f5dcd86b6a779c7a003a3577e26e8fbb685559cb
spent
true